Comme pour l’entrée de glossaire, le groupe de glossaire doit contenir un seul élément racine <glossgroup> avec un attribut id qui contient un élément <title> et un ou plusieurs éléments <glossterm> ou <glossgroup>, chacun avec un attribut id.
Remarque :
Cette leçon couvre l’utilisation de base des éléments groupe de glossaire. Pour les spécifications complètes de chaque élément, voir la norme OASIS DITA version 1.2.
Vidéo : Créer un groupe de glossaire DITA
Pratique
- Faites une copie du fichier l_debut_glossgroup.dita et ouvrez-le dans votre éditeur.
Remarque : Si vous utilisez un éditeur DITA, assurez-vous que vous êtes en mode texte plutôt qu’en mode auteur ou visuel.
Vous devriez voir ceci :
<?xml version="1.0" encoding="utf-8"?>
<!DOCTYPE glossgroup PUBLIC "-//OASIS//DTD DITA Glossary Group//EN" "glossgroup.dtd">
<glossgroup id="equipement_canard">
<title></title>
</glossgroup>
La première ligne (qui commence par <?xml) est une déclaration XML, qui est une partie standard à tous les fichiers XML.
La deuxième ligne est la déclaration DOCTYPE, qui indique aux éditeurs ou aux générateurs de publication DITA qu’il s’agit d’un groupe de glossaire DITA. Les programmes utilisent ensuite cette information pour valider le contenu de la rubrique. Le DOCTYPE sera spécifique à chaque type de rubrique que vous créez.
La troisième ligne contient la balise d’ouverture de l’élément <glossgroup>. L’attribut id associé à l’élément <glossgroup> est obligatoire.
La quatrième ligne contient l’élément <title>.
- À l’intérieur de l’élément <title>, ajoutez un titre qui aidera à identifier le groupe de glossaire.
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E glossgroup PUBLIC "-//OASIS//DTD DITA Glossary Group//EN" "glossgroup.dtd">
<glossgroup id="equipement_canard">
<title>Matériel d'observation des canards</title>
</glossgroup>
Bien que l’élément <title> soit requis dans le cadre du modèle de contenu, vous n’avez pas nécessairement besoin d’y ajouter du contenu.
- Après l’élément <title>, ajoutez quatre éléments <glossentry> avec des attributs id.
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E glossgroup PUBLIC "-//OASIS//DTD DITA Glossary Group//EN" "glossgroup.dtd">
<glossgroup id="equipement_canard">
<title>Matériel d'observation des canards</title>
<glossentry id=""></glossentry>
<glossentry id=""></glossentry>
<glossentry id=""></glossentry>
<glossentry id=""></glossentry>
</glossgroup>
- À l’intérieur de chaque élément <glossentry>, ajoutez un élément <glossterm> et renseignez les attributs id.
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E glossgroup PUBLIC "-//OASIS//DTD DITA Glossary Group//EN" "glossgroup.dtd">
<glossgroup id="equipement_canard">
<title>Matériel d'observation des canards</title>
<glossentry id="jumelles">
<glossterm>Jumelles</glossterm>
</glossentry>
<glossentry id="appats">
<glossterm>Appâts pour canards</glossterm>
</glossentry>
<glossentry id="appeau">
<glossterm>Appeau</glossterm>
</glossentry>
<glossentry id="telescope">
<glossterm>Téléscope d'observation</glossterm>
</glossentry>
</glossgroup>
- Après chaque élément <glossterm>, ajoutez un élément <glossdef> avec les définitions.
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E glossgroup PUBLIC "-//OASIS//DTD DITA Glossary Group//EN" "glossgroup.dtd">
<glossgroup id="equipement_canard">
<title>Matériel d'observation des canards</title>
<glossentry id="jumelles">
<glossterm>jumelles</glossterm>
<glossdef>Dispositif optique destiné à être utilisé avec les deux yeux pour voir des objets éloignés</glossdef>
</glossentry>
<glossentry id="appats">
<glossterm>appâts pour canards</glossterm>
<glossdef>Appât utilisé pour attirer les canards. Peut aller des granulés spéciaux au pain blanc bon marché</glossdef>
</glossentry>
<glossentry id="appeau">
<glossterm>appeau</glossterm>
<glossdef>Dispositif constitué d'un tube contenant un roseau, utilisé pour imiter et attirer les canards</glossdef>
</glossentry>
<glossentry id="telescope">
<glossterm>téléscope d'observation</glossterm>
<glossdef>Dispositif optique destiné à être utilisé avec un seul œil, qui permet une vision plus détaillée que les jumelles</glossdef>
</glossentry>
</glossgroup>
Contributeurs